The word is in the Wiktionary4 short excerpts of Wiktionnary (A collaborative project to produce a free-content dictionary.)— English words —- subdeacon n. (Catholicism, chiefly historical) A Catholic clerical rank in the major orders below that of a deacon.
- subdeacon n. (Catholicism, chiefly historical) A Catholic cleric who assists the deacon at High Mass and normally…
- subdeacon n. (Eastern Christianity) The highest of the minor orders below that of a deacon.
- sub-deacon n. Alternative spelling of subdeacon.
